Long-Term Immunocastration Protocols Successfully Reduce Testicles' Size in Bísaro Pigs.

Abstract

This study aimed to find a suitable immunocastration protocol for male Bísaro pigs (BP) due to the breed and production system particularities. Twenty-five male BP were treated with Improvac according to three protocols: using two (GrpE2 and L2) or three vaccinations (GrpL3) and starting at 9 (GrpE2) or 13 weeks old (GrpL2 and L3). Eleven animals were kept as intact males (GrpC). Scrotal measurements and the morphometry of the testes and epididymides collected at slaughter were used to survey the effectiveness of the immunocastration compared with the age-matched intact controls. Animals in groups E2 and L3 were kept until 57 weeks, after a second vaccination cycle at 49 and 53 weeks of age. Scrotal dimensions decreased to almost initial values in treated animals until 17 (GrpE2) and 21 weeks (GrpL2 and L3), thereafter increasing to post-pubertal values until around 29 or 37 weeks of age for groups E2 and L2, respectively, but only at 41 weeks in group L3. Between 41 and 49 weeks, scrotal dimensions were similar in treated and control animals, decreasing to the predicted pre-puberty size after the second cycle of vaccination. This study suggests the most suited protocol for males slaughtered at older ages includes three administrations of Improvac starting at 3 months of age, followed by a second vaccination cycle.

由于品种和生产系统的特殊性,本研究旨在为雄性比萨罗猪(BP)找到合适的免疫去势方案。25头雄性BP按照三种方案用英帕瓦克进行处理:采用两次(E2组和L2组)或三次疫苗接种(L3组),分别在9周龄(E2组)或13周龄(L2组和L3组)开始。11头动物作为未去势雄性饲养(C组)。与年龄匹配的未去势对照相比,通过屠宰时收集的阴囊测量以及睾丸和附睾的形态测量来评估免疫去势的效果。E2组和L3组的动物在49周和53周龄进行第二次疫苗接种周期后,饲养至57周。处理过的动物阴囊尺寸在17周(E2组)和21周(L2组和L3组)前降至几乎初始值,此后分别在E2组和L2组约29周或37周龄时增加至青春期后的值,但L3组仅在41周时增加。在41至49周之间,处理过的动物和对照动物的阴囊尺寸相似,在第二次疫苗接种周期后降至预测的青春期前大小。本研究表明,对于老龄屠宰的雄性猪,最适合的方案是从3月龄开始进行三次英帕瓦克接种,随后进行第二次疫苗接种周期。
